Can A Paramedic Afford Rent in El Sobrante, CA?

Rent-burdened — rent takes 49.4% of gross income.

El Sobrante rent: July 2026. Salary: BLS OEWS May 2024 (California state estimate).

El Sobrante median rent
$2,582/mo
Paramedic salary (California)
$62,752/yr
Rent as % of income
49.4%
Gross monthly income works out to about $5,229, and the 30% rule supports up to $1,569/mo in rent. El Sobrante's median rent of $2,582 exceeds that threshold by $1,013/mo, putting a paramedic salary into the rent-burdened range here. A paramedic works roughly 85.6 hours a month to cover that rent.

About rent and a paramedic salary

Paramedic and EMT base pay sits modestly below the US median household income and is often supplemented by overtime. At the national-average paramedic salary, the 30% rule supports about $1,330 a month in rent.

Methodology: Salary uses the BLS-derived California state estimate from OEWS May 2024. Rent is the most recent ZORI monthly value for El Sobrante, CA. Affordability applies the 30% rule (rent ≤ 30% of gross income). Real take-home varies with taxes, household composition, overtime, tips, and benefits.
